Armies of Greyhawk Miniatures – WIP

Eventually the goal of the Armies of Greyhawk series is to have real miniature armies that I can bring to conventions to run battles in the Flanaess. I thought it would be interesting to share what I’ve got so far, to give you an idea of what they look like.

These are all very much works in progress, and some are recycled from previous miniatures projects, so long-term readers might recognize some of them. They’re all metal 15mm, coming from a variety of sources; Splintered Light (the pig-faced orcs), Old Glory 15’s, Essex, Blue Moon, and others.

The pics below show Paynims, Snow Barbarians, Palish, South Province, generic knights, orcs (x2), Sunndi, and some wood elves/Sunndi mounted crossbowmen.
